The Browning School is a K-12 boys school located on East 62nd Street (Lower and Middle Schools) and East 64th Street (Upper School) in midtown Manhattan, New York. Founded by scholar and teacher John A. Browning, The Browning School has been a leader in fostering the intellectual and personal growth of boys and young men since 1888. Serving roughly 470 students in kindergarten through grade 12, Browning strives to combine the best of a traditional prep school environment and curriculum with imaginative teaching and a strong value system – all in a single-sex setting.

 

POSITION DESCRIPTION

 

Browning is searching for a full-time Lower School Associate Teacher for the 2026-2027 academic year. The position will begin on or around August 27, 2026. The expected annual salary for this position is $59,000. A bachelor’s degree or considerable experience in the role is required. Applicants must be eligible to work in the United States.

 

Key Responsibilities

 

Lower School Associate Teachers support teaching and learning in Grades K-3 classrooms at Browning. This role will be in kindergarten, second, or third grade for the 2026-2027 school year. Associate teachers are responsible for building strong relationships with students and head teachers in order to deliver the content and curriculum of the Browning program. Successful associate teachers believe in and desire the growth of all their students and have a passion for the art, craft, and science of pedagogy. Ultimately, teachers are responsible for the most important work of our School -- knowing our boys and teaching them well. Among other things, a Lower School Associate Teacher is responsible for:

 

  • Partnering with head teacher(s) in delivering instruction in literacy, writing, mathematics, and social studies
  • Shepherding both the social-emotional and academic growth of the boys in the classroom
  • Supporting the development of a positive and inclusive classroom environment
  • Communicating effectively with students, parents, and colleagues

Requirements

  • A bachelor’s degree or considerable experience in the role
  • Eligibility to work in the United States
  • Ability to build strong relationships with students and head teachers
  • Passion for teaching and learning
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ills
